Company overview

Inmarsat is the world's leading provider of global mobile satellite communications. The company provides voice and high-speed data services to almost anywhere on the planet - on land, at sea and in the air and operates 11 satellites in geostationary orbit 35,786km above the Earth, controlled from its HQ in London via ground stations located around the globe.

HL Comment (9 March 2010)

Satellite communications company Inmarsat recently (9th March 2010) unveiled a 12 per cent rise in full-year operating profit. Total revenue rose to $181.5 million from $160.6million in the fourth quarter of 2008, with the group’s maritime sector growing sales by 10 per cent and the land mobile sector growing turnover by 8 per cent. The aeronautical sector grew revenue by 13 per cent while the leasing division saw an  improvement of 29.2 per cent. Revenue was boosted by strong demand for broadband in remote areas. About 40 per cent of Inmarsat's business is derived from government and long-term contracts, which are less affected by the performance of the wider economy and more resilient in a downturn. The company expects to be able to grow revenue at a sustainable pace over the coming years through a series of new product launches and a new broadband service through its Por Constellation satellites that were launched over the course of 2009.

Negative Points:
  • The US communications regulator recently outlined a national broadband plan which would allow satellite operators to use their radio spectrum for internet traffic. A protracted delay in deregulation in the US could prove a hindrance to new growth opportunities.
  • A significant share stake held by US hedge fund (Harbinger Capital) could provide a drag on the share price if sold to traditional investors.

Positive Points:
  • Data services now represent almost 90 per cent of Inmarsat’s volume and 80 per cent of its revenue.
  • Demand for satellite technology is consistent in good and bad markets.
  • The group anticipates high demand for broadband services and its entry into the handheld satellite phone voice market in 2010.
  • Inmarsat declared a second interim dividend of 20.63 cents a share.
